History tells us that candy makers Melesio Pérez and Natalia Medina were suppliers for giant dulce de leche sweets from the area and desired to broaden the business. Natalia built compact, round pieces of dulce de leche candy, included them in pecans, and wrapped them in purple cellophane. As to the name, There are 2 theories: a single states that she named the sweet following her granddaughter Gloria, and one other claims that certainly one of her customers tried out the candy and mentioned it tasted like glory.

Mazapán — De la Rosa would be the brand — can be a spherical disk of floor peanuts and sugar pressed alongside one another. It’s technically a strong, nevertheless it has a strategy for equally breaking off and then melting with your mouth that’s just so gratifying.
